METHOD FOR INCREASING IMMUNOGENICITY OF VACCINES AGAINST ANTHRAX AND BLACKLEG INFECTIONS

The invention relates to veterinary immunology, namely to a method for enhancing immune response in vaccination of animals against such infections as anthrax and blackleg. The invention is aimed at solving the problem of creating a method for increasing immunogenicity of vaccines against anthrax and blackleg due to simultaneous reduction of immunising dose and reactogenicity of vaccines. The method is realised in the following way. Healthy animals (guinea pigs) are immunised with either anti-anthrax vaccine based on anthrax avirulent strain Bacillus anthracis 55 SSNINRRIVV&M or anti-blackleg vaccine based on inactivated culture of virulent strain of blackleg, with each of vaccines being diluted with isotonic solution of sodium chloride with concentration 0.85-0.95% in ratio not higher than 1:9 and injected subcutaneously in dose 0.4-0.6 ml per unit. Immunomodulator is injected to animals subcutaneously 30-40 min after immunisation. As immunomodulator used is preparation in form of mixture of aqueous formaldehyde solution of 36.5-40.0% concentration and isotonic sodium chloride solution of 0.85-0.95% concentration with ratio of constituent parts of solutions equal 2-6:994-998.
